Established in 1993, the Million Dollar Advocates Forum is a diverse group of US trial lawyers composed of members who have proven to be highly skilled, experienced, and knowledgeable in the largest and most complicated cases. Fewer than 1% of lawyers in the United States are members of the Million Dollar Advocates Forum, and currently the forum includes around 4, 000 members. Whether by trial, arbitration or settlement, if the award was by periodic payments or structured settlement, the one million dollar amount must apply to the economic present value of the award, not the overall payout amount.
